Boundaries are Essential for Self-Preservation

How do we set new boundaries as our world has turned upside down?  With updated restrictions on physical distancing & ways to mitigate the spread of this new coronavirus, being able to set boundaries is even more critical for our own health and well-being, let alone for others.

The New Normal:  Physical Distancing

What do we say when someone wants to get together during stay-at-home orders?  How do we respond when someone is coming closer than the 6+ feet recommendations?  What about if one of our housemates is an essential worker and is at higher risk of infection and spread?

What may have sounded rude before is now a legitimate and compassionate response.

Example Scripts for Stating New COVID-19 Boundaries

Here are some examples of ways to communicate new #COVID19 boundaries:
​
  1. I don’t want to talk about Coronavirus right now.
  2. I get that you’re trying to be helpful by sharing resources, but right now I need time to feel my emotions.
  3. I’m choosing to stay home right now and limiting my contact with people.
  4. I respect your opinion but I’m coming to my own conclusions
  5. I love how informed you are but I don’t want to receive links right now.​
